2017-04-22 14 views
0

neo4jでは、ContactIdとLookedupStatusに基づいて結果を降順で並べ替える必要があります。neo4jの2つのノードに基づく注文

このクエリでは、ContactIdに基づいて結果を順序付けするだけでは、両方のp.ContactIdに命じるとp.LookedupStatusように、上記のクエリを変更する方法

MATCH (p:Contact)<-[:RELATIONSHIP]-(d:GroupMember) 
    WHERE toint(d.GroupId) = 55 
    and p.EmailId<>'' 
    RETURN p 
    order by toint(p.ContactId) desc 

答えて

3

あなたは、ソート条件を組み合わせることができます。

UNWIND [ {a:3, b:2, c: 1}, {a:1, b:2, c: 2}, 
     {a:1, b:1, c: 3}, {a:3, b:1, c: 4} ] as n 
RETURN n ORDER BY n.a DESC, 
        n.b ASC 
関連する問題